Output 5f758fcbd8a8719951516e6babb1fb2dc359218aee48e212d175d3632257c065:95

value
388926
script pubkey
OP_0 OP_PUSHBYTES_20 dd6f67b458101d5a0ec98c5baeac84d1e414f98e
address
bc1qm4hk0dzczqw45rkf33d6atyy68jpf7vwnkuufs
transaction
5f758fcbd8a8719951516e6babb1fb2dc359218aee48e212d175d3632257c065
spent
true